Facts
Verizon occupies approximately 60% of the building. Their current lease expires in 2012. |
The building was located on the extreme southern end of the lot due to a height limit for buildings within 200 feet of the Ben Franklin Parkway. |
The northern part of the lot is occupied by a shaded, landscaped plaza and a fountain. |
